2nd Edition of Grow and Eat your own Food receives funding

 

Nature Seychelles has received funding from the United States’ ambassador’s self-help programme to publish the second edition of the popular sustainable lifestyle book, Grow and Eat your Own FoodThe funds were received at a signing ceremony held at the Liaison Unit for Non-Governmental Organisation (LUNGOS) held on 2 May with US ambassador to Seychelles Shari Villarosa.
3 other Non-governmental Organisations - Association for People with Hearing Impairment (APHI), Alliance of Solidarity for the Family (ASFF) and Centre d’Accueil de la Rosière (Car) - signed funding agreements under the programme.

Ms Villarosa said non-governmental organisations and community groups play an important role in addressing the needs of their communities. “We welcome more project proposals to address the other important community needs in Seychelles,” she said.
Lungos chairperson Marie-Nella Azemia thanked the US embassy for making available funds for local non-governmental organisations to tap into and commended these bodies for their projects
A total of US $18,791 have been allocated to fund the four projects.
